Hey, welcome to the Brindlewood platform team! You'll hear a lot about the flaky DNS issue — our internal resolver at the Kestrel cluster sometimes drops lookups under load. Diagnostics live in the netops vault, which you'll need early on. To unlock it, use the recovery passphrase printed just below.

unlock words, hahip-yagef: zorok-novmir-zorix-silax

Subject: Session-token refresh bug — what support needs to know

Hi team,

Welcome to the rotation. A known bug in Keyline's token refresher occasionally logs users out mid-session after a refresh race. Users should be told to sign back in; no data is lost. A fix ships next sprint. Workarounds and the tracking ticket are on the internal page below.

runbook for badug-kadup: https://confluence.zemvarlabs.internal/projects/browse/display/projects/bd1b

For the 3.2 release of Spokewise, the rebalancing planner now recomputes station targets every cycle rather than nightly. Please note the solver is sensitive to its weighting constants; changing them mid-release requires a fresh simulation run against the Caldermouth network snapshot. All values are frozen at code cut and shipped in the release bundle. The constants included in this release are these.

tuning constants:
RATE_LIMITS = {
    "wenwyn": 1,
    "zorix": 10,
    "oliix": 2,
    "holael": 10,
}